Did you have a theme for your wedding?

We had a slight travel theme for our wedding; we didn’t want it to be the main feature but had little touches here and there. We used a map for our table plan, our table names were countries we had visited together, the favours were small ‘airmail packages’ filled with chocolate hearts and kisses and we had a postcard guest book.
